A customer abused a bank employee at the counter.
Used harsh words. Questioned his competence. Made a scene in front of everyone.
What happened next?
The bank called the employee and told him to apologize to the customer.
Not the customer. The employee.
I have heard this story more times than I can count. Across PSU banks, across branches, across states. The faces change. The script does not.
And every time I hear it, I ask the same question nobody wants to answer:
What does this do to a person?
You wake up at 7. You reach the branch by 9. You handle 200 customers, 15 targets, 3 inspections, and 1 rude officer. You stay late. You miss your kid’s function. You do all of this for a salary that barely crosses Rs 40,000 in hand at junior levels.
And when someone comes to your counter and decides to insult you, the institution you work for tells you to say sorry to that person.
Not because you did something wrong.
But because the customer is always right. Even when the customer is wrong.
This is not a customer service policy.
This is an instruction to forget you have dignity.
And the saddest part is that most employees comply. Not because they want to. Because they are afraid. Afraid of a complaint. Afraid of a transfer. Afraid of an adverse remark in their ACR.
The bank knows this. That is why the policy works.
I spent years inside a PSU bank. I saw what this does to people slowly. A person who joined with confidence starts walking with his head down. Not because he is weak. Because the system spent years teaching him to be small.
Here is what nobody says out loud:
A monthly salary does not buy your self-respect. Your employer has no right to it. And a customer who abuses you is not a stakeholder. He is a person who behaved badly and was never told so.
If bank managements genuinely respected their employees, they would say this to the customer:
“We understand your concern. But our staff will not be spoken to this way. Please raise your complaint in writing.”
Full stop.
That one sentence would change the entire culture.
But that sentence has never been said. And that tells you everything you need to know about how this institution views the people who run it.

Deeply saddened by the unfortunate demise of Shri Bishal Brata Roy, a newly recruited DRO at Bank of Baroda. This tragic incident highlights the importance of continuously reviewing workplace conditions, employee well-being, and support systems in the banking sector.
The time calls for constructive introspection on training, staffing levels, workload management, transfer policies, mental health support, and employee-friendly HR practices.
A strong banking system must be built not only on performance, but also on the well-being, dignity, and professional growth of its workforce.
Heartfelt condolences to the bereaved family.

Bankers point out that other key financial and government bodies — including the Reserve Bank of India (RBI), SEBI,NABARD, LIC, GIC, stock exchanges, and central/state offices — already operate on a Monday–Friday schedule.
